Output 529004b6feb76e75e4edf06a38e31f2eb2d1798f45f2e1b26711960740e5d08d:1

value
27428893
script pubkey
OP_0 OP_PUSHBYTES_20 bb1419fb0aeb179e54e1d81887133cfa82f22a28
address
bc1qhv2pn7c2avteu48pmqvgwyeul2p0y23gyzla6p
transaction
529004b6feb76e75e4edf06a38e31f2eb2d1798f45f2e1b26711960740e5d08d
spent
true